One More Level, the studio behind the acclaimed Ghostrunner series, is known for its fast-paced, brutal action games set in cyberpunk worlds. Ghostrunner's demanding gameplay hinges on precise planning, agility, and lightning-fast reflexes. One-hit kills are the norm for the protagonist, who possesses equally limited survivability. The critical and commercial success of the Ghostrunner franchise is undeniable, with the first game achieving average scores of 81% and 79%, and the sequel scoring 80% and 76%.
Today, One More Level revealed a new image hinting at their next project. The studio is currently developing two games: Cyber Slash and Project Swift. Given Project Swift's 2028 release date, the newly revealed image almost certainly pertains to Cyber Slash.

Cyber Slash transports players to the first half of the 19th century, offering a dark and thrilling reimagining of the Napoleonic era. Expect an epic adventure filled with legendary heroes battling unknown forces and terrifying threats.
Gameplay promises a challenging and action-packed experience, diverging from traditional Souls-like mechanics. While parrying and exploiting enemy weaknesses remain crucial, the protagonist will undergo mutations throughout the game, adding a unique evolutionary element to the combat.
